NXT WOMEN’S TITLE MATCH QUALIFIER: Liv Morgan vs. Nikki Cross vs. Payton Royce (w/Billie Kay)- 6/10
Nikki has her own jazzed-up version of the SAnitY theme which also has her own mad laughing in the beginning. The match was a standard three-way until the Undisputed Era came out with Taynara Conti, giving her a pep-talk to get her to charge down to the ring and try to screw over Nikki Cross, which she did by first breaking up a pin and then distracting her. I don’t know whether this means that Conti is now part of their group or whether they are just duping her into attacking Cross for them as a way to get back at SAnitY, but my instincts lean towards the latter.

LIO RUSH vs. THE VELVETEEN DREAM- 5/10
They gave Lio a lot of offense, but once he got cut off it felt like he got pinned almost immediately, which made him look very bad, IMO. If I were booking this I would have had Dream win with some sort of heel finish to protect Lio a bit and to emphasize a believable way for him to both have a shot of beating Aleister Black and get Black to say his name (likely in a fit of rage).

LARS SULLIVAN vs. DANNY BURCH- 2/10
Pretty much a squash.

THE STREET PROPHETS vs. MARCOS ESPADA & DAMIEN SMITH- squash.
I love the Street Prophets (by which I mean I love Montez Ford and Angelo Dawkins serves as a competent body to be his tag team partner). They celebrated in the crowd after their victory.

We’re getting SAnitY vs. Undisputed Era next week! Also, there is another women’s title qualifier featuring Ruby Riot, Ember Moon, and Sonya Deville.

JOHNNY GARGANO vs. ANDRADE “CIEN” ALMAS (w/Zelena Vega)- 8/10
Wait… I thought this match was happening at Takeover. Oh well. I guess I’ll just have to watch this awesome match now instead of in a few weeks. The story here was that both men had each other’s moves scouted, but that was a really just a backdrop for the spot where Vega tried to distract Johnny by wearing a DIY shirt. It caused enough of a distraction that Almas was able to escape the Garga-No Escape, but Johnny seemed to recover quickly afterwards, leaving open the possibility that maybe he will finally be over Ciampa turning on him. Almas and Vega needed to engage in further heel tactics to pick up the win.

A very fun show from NXT with an awesome main event. Go watch it!
